▲ 【Kamishikimi Kumanoimasu Shrine】 With towering cedar trees and deep stone steps, this ancient shrine nestled in the mountains is well-known for the anime "Natsume's Book of Friends." Morning light spills over the moss, creating a serene and peaceful atmosphere. It is recommended to slowly walk up the approach, capturing the interplay of stone lanterns and the forest, or make a wish by the "rock-piercing" cave, opening the quiet prelude to today's journey.

▲ 【Mount Aso】 Mount Aso is famous for its vast volcanic landscape. Standing on the observation deck, you can overlook the crater area and feel the quiet flow of the earth's power. The crater of Mount Aso has a strong sulfur smell; those sensitive to odors may bring a mask. The opening of the Aso crater is subject to the official announcement of the day. ▲ 【Kusasenri】 This is a vast highland grassland with changing landscapes throughout the seasons. When the breeze blows, it feels like a foreign prairie. Horses leisurely stroll in the distance, adding vivid scenes to this journey. It is recommended to walk along the trail, stopping now and then to capture the natural beauty where blue sky, green fields, and distant mountains meet.



▲ 【Kurokawa Onsen】 A hot spring town hidden in the mountains, known for its simple wooden architecture and quiet streets. You can choose to soak in the hot springs (at your own expense) or stroll along the old street, tasting local snacks and enjoying a leisurely pace of life. The autumn valley with red leaves and open-air hot springs is particularly famous.
